Forbes: Actors’ Strike Fallout: ‘Oppenheimer’ Cast Walks Out Of U.K. Premiere After SAG Announces Strike
The cast of 'Oppenheimer' walked out of the U.K. premiere in solidarity with the strike called by SAG-AFTRA, the union representing screen actors, in conjunction with Hollywood writers. Matt Damon, Emily Blunt, Robert Downey Jr., and Cillian Murphy, along with director Christopher Nolan, expressed their support for fair wages. This marks the first time in over 60 years that both actors and writers in Hollywood are striking simultaneously.

Flag And Cross: Genetically Modified Poplar Trees Offer Greener And Cheaper Diapers
Scientists have used CRISPR gene-editing technology to breed genetically modified poplar trees with halved levels of lignin, a major barrier to efficient production of wood fibers. By reducing lignin, the trees can produce softer wood that is easier to convert into paper, clothing fillings, and even diapers. The gene-edited trees also showed potential for increased pulp yield and reduced greenhouse gas emissions, making them more sustainable for the environment. This development could lead to more sustainable and eco-friendly diapers in the future.
Flag And Cross: Astronomers Discover Coldest Star Emitting Radio Waves
Astronomers have identified the coldest star yet, known as an "ultracool brown dwarf," that emits radio waves. The star, named T8 Dwarf WISE J062309.94−045624.6, has a surface temperature of about 425 degrees Centigrade and is the coolest star analyzed using radio astronomy. It is rare for ultracool brown dwarf stars to produce radio emission, but the discovery of this star will help deepen our understanding of stars and their magnetic fields.

Flag And Cross: Apple's IOS 17 To Introduce Personalized Speech Assistant
Apple's upcoming iOS 17 introduces a new feature that allows iPhone users to create a personalized speech assistant that sounds like them. Users can access this feature by navigating to the Accessibility settings and selecting "Personal Voice" under the Speech section. Through a 15-minute process of reading out text prompts, the device creates a synthesized voice that resembles the user's own voice.
